
Britney Spears' dad, Jamie, will be in charge of her affairs through the summer.
Court public information officer Allan Parachini confirms to PageSix.com that lawyers for Jamie filed an unexpected ex-parte motion in the matter today, and Commissioner Goetz extended the conservatorship through July 31.
Parachini also tells us that the original hearing on the case, scheduled for March 10, is still on the calendar and will take place. Also on the horizon for Brit: a custody hearing (on Monday as well), and a hearing on the temporary restraining order against Sam Lutfi (on March 17).
In addition to extending his conservatorship, PageSix.com has learned that America's busiest dad attended the deposition of Michael Sands today in connection to the custody case.
Sands, a former spokesperson for Kevin Federline's lawyer, Mark Vincent Kaplan, currently speaks for Sam Lutfi and Jon Eardley, the attorney who failed in an attempt to get all of Brit's cases moved to federal court.
